The Conquest of the Americas The Conquistadores

OVERVIEW Fall of the Aztec and Inca Empires Spanish Conquistadores in Florida Reason for Spanish Exploration in Southwest (North America) Economies, Government, and Social Structure of Spanish colonial society

What is a Conquistador? Definition: –Spanish soldiers who led military expeditions in the Americas. –Derived from the term Conquista which was Spain’s attempt to gain control in the Americas and Asia Pacific for a political and economic advantage. –Justified their expeditions in the Americas, which were often-times brutal, with their Roman Catholic faith and cultural views.

Cortes and the Aztecs Hernan Cortes, conquistador –S–Sent by the Spanish governor of Cuba to present day Mexico in –W–Went in search of Moctezuma II. King of the Aztec Empire Rich Civilization with millions of people. Malintzin was an Aztec civilian and interpreter for Cortes Capitol fell to Cortes after Moctezuma died and then the city suffered form small pox

Pizarro’s Conquest of the Inca Francisco Pizarro –Arrived in Peru in 1531 Inca Empire –Geographically covered most of the western side of South America, form present-day Columbia to Chile –Atahualpa was the ruler Pizarro and Atahualpa –Pizarro takes Atahualpa prisoner and is paid gold for his ransom, but Pizarro murders him anyway. Inca Empire is conquered in 1534 after the death of Atahualpa and an epidemic of small pox.

Conquistadores in Florida First effort –Juan Ponce de Leon Reached present day Florida in 1513 Attempted to found a settlement in 1521 (failed) Second Effort –Panfilo de Narvaez In 1528 reached Florida Starving, he and his crew try to escape Florida in make-shift rafts Only a few survived –Alvar Nunez Cabeza de Vaca reached the Texas coast –Cabeza de Vaca wandered for 8 years living with Natives until he found some Spanish soldiers coming out of Mexico in w01/Cabeza_de_Vaca.htmlhttp:// w01/Cabeza_de_Vaca.html Sailed on Columbus’s second voyage.

Hernan de Soto Sought Gold in North America First europeans to cross Mississippi River Became ill and died near the mouth of the Mississippi

Francisco Vasquez de Coronado Traveled to New Mexico in 1540 Captured Zuni town of Cibola Was in search of gold and other riches Only found buildings and corn.

Juan Rodriguez Cabrillo Sailed along California coast in In search of gold and new route to China Did not return from voyage because he died in 1543 Fought with Cortes in the defeat of the Aztec. (was a master of the crossbow) Served as governor of Guatemala.
